在计算机编程中,延迟执行是指将一段代码的执行推迟到稍后的时间点。在 BAT(批处理)脚本中,可以使用一些命令和技巧来实现延迟执行。

一种常见的延迟执行的方法是使用'ping'命令来实现。'ping'命令可以用来向指定的 IP 地址发送网络数据包,并等待接收响应。通过设置适当的等待时间,可以实现延迟执行的效果。

以下是一个示例,展示了如何在 BAT 脚本中使用'ping'命令来延迟执行:

@echo off
echo 正在延迟执行...
ping 127.0.0.1 -n 2 > nul
echo 延迟执行完成!

在上面的示例中,'ping 127.0.0.1 -n 2'命令将向本地主机发送两个网络数据包,并等待接收响应。'> nul'用于将命令的输出重定向到空设备,以避免在屏幕上显示不必要的信息。

通过设置适当的等待时间,可以实现不同程度的延迟执行。在上面的示例中,'-n 2'参数指定发送两个网络数据包,每个数据包之间的等待时间由系统默认的超时时间决定。

请注意,使用'ping'命令来实现延迟执行并不是一种精确的方法,因为实际的延迟时间可能会受到系统负载、网络延迟等因素的影响。如果需要更精确的延迟执行,可以考虑使用其他编程语言或工具来实现。

BAT 脚本延迟执行技巧:使用 ping 命令实现延时

原文地址: https://www.cveoy.top/t/topic/o7Vb 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录